The Evolution of IELTS in China

The British Council, in collaboration with the National Education Examinations Authority (NEEA) in China, has gradually updated the testing process. While the paper-based and computer-delivered tests at physical centers remain popular, the introduction of "IELTS Online" represents a significant turning point. It allows prospects to take the Academic module from the convenience of their homes, provided they meet specific software and hardware criteria.

It is essential to compare IELTS on Computer (taken at a safe and secure test center) and IELTS Online (taken in your home). While both are digital, the latter offers a level of convenience formerly unavailable to those living in remote provinces or those with hectic professional schedules.

Technical Requirements for IELTS Online in China

Taking a high-stakes exam like the IELTS online needs a stable environment to prevent technical disqualification. Due to the particular nature of internet connection in China, candidates should ensure their setup is optimized.

Important Hardware and Software List:

  1. Computer: A laptop computer or desktop (Tablets and smart phones are not allowed).
  2. Running System: Windows 10 or 11, or macOS 10.15 and above.
  3. Web browser: The newest variation of Google Chrome.
  4. Web Connection: A stable download/upload speed of a minimum of 2Mbps.
  5. Peripherals: A working cam and a wired headset (cordless Bluetooth headphones are often discouraged due to prospective latency or battery problems).
  6. The Inspera Exam Portal: This is the specific software application used to deliver the IELTS Online. Prospects need to download and evaluate this software application prior to their examination day.

The Registration Process in China

In Mainland China, the main portal for all IELTS registrations is the NEEA IELTS site (ielts.neea.edu.cn). Prospects seeking to obtain an online certificate must follow a standardized treatment:

  1. Account Creation: Register a distinct NEEA ID on the main site.
  2. Module Selection: Select "IELTS Online" (Academic) particularly.
  3. Payment: Pay the registration fee by means of UnionPay, AliPay, or WeChat Pay. Keep in mind that the charge for the online variation might vary a little from the center-based examinations.
  4. System Check: Upon registration, prospects get an email to perform a compulsory system check to guarantee their computer can deal with the Inspera software.
  5. Reserving the Slot: Choose a date and time that matches your schedule. Slots are frequently available 24/7 to accommodate various time zones.

The Test Experience: What to Expect

The IELTS Online test corresponds the center-based variation in terms of content, trouble, and scoring. It includes 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.

Listening, Reading, and Writing

These three areas are completed in one sitting. The screen layout is designed for user-friendliness, enabling prospects to highlight text and include notes digitally. Strategic use of the "split-screen" view in the Reading section helps candidates view both the text and the questions all at once.

The Speaking Test

Unlike the other elements, the Speaking test is an one-on-one interview with a licensed IELTS inspector by means of an integrated video call. This remains a "human" interaction to make sure the assessment of communicative competence is accurate. In China, inspectors may be located in various time zones, so punctuality is crucial.

Security and Integrity: Anti-Cheating Measures

A common issue relating to the IELTS certificate obtained online is the validity of the results. To preserve the greatest requirements, the British Council employs a multi-layered security method:

  • Remote Proctoring: A live human proctor monitors the prospect via the cam throughout the exam.
  • AI Monitoring: Software tracks eye movements and discovers if the candidate tries to open other tabs or applications.
  • Space Scan: Before beginning, the prospect must utilize their cam to show a 360-degree view of their room to make sure no unauthorized materials or individuals exist.
  • ID Verification: Rigorous identity checks are performed using the candidate's passport before the session begins.

Recognition of the IELTS Online Certificate

Before choosing the online path, Chinese prospects need to verify if their target organization accepts IELTS Online. While the majority of universities in the UK, Australia, and Canada accept it for undergraduate and postgraduate admissions, there are exceptions:

  • Visa Requirements: For particular "UKVI" (UK Visas and Immigration) applications, a specific "IELTS for UKVI" test taken at a physical, high-security center is typically obligatory.
  • General Training: Those seeking permanent residency in Canada (Express Entry) usually need the IELTS General Training module, which is currently not readily available in the online format.
  • Institutional Policy: Some specific conservative professors or federal government bodies may still choose the standard Test Report Form (TRF) from a physical center.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Is the IELTS Online certificate various from the one issued at a test center?

The digital certificate (e-TRF) includes the exact same info and brings the same weight for scholastic admissions. However, it will clearly specify that the test was taken online.

2. Can I use a VPN while taking the IELTS Online in China?

No. Utilizing a VPN is strictly forbidden during the test as it can interfere with the proctoring software application and may be flagged as suspicious activity. The IELTS Online platform is developed to function within the Chinese network environment without a VPN.

3. What occurs if my internet stops working throughout the test?

If a technical concern occurs, candidates should call the assistance team right away via the chat function in the software application. Depending upon the severity and duration of the outage, the test might be rescheduled.

4. Can I buy an IELTS certificate online without taking the exam?

No. Any site or service declaring to sell "genuine" IELTS certificates without an examination is a rip-off. IELTS outcomes are verified by universities through an online confirmation service. Fraudulent certificates will lead to permanent bans from the test and rejection of visa or university applications.

5. Is the Speaking test tape-recorded?

Yes, the Speaking test is tape-recorded for quality assurance and saying functions, making sure the highest level of fairness for the prospect.
